Incontestable (Al-Haaqqah)
In the name of Allah, the Compassionate, the Merciful
۞ The Inevitable Reality - 1 What is the sure calamity! 2 And what have you understood, how tremendous the true event is! 3 The people of Thamud and Ad denied the Day of Judgment. 4 Then the Thamud were destroyed by an awesome upheaval; 5 And as for 'Aad they were destroyed by a wind, furious, roaring. 6 which continued to strike them for seven nights and eight days so that eventually you could see the people lying dead like the hollow trunks of uprooted palm-trees. 7 Do you then see of them one remaining? 8 Pharoah and those before him and the inhabitants of the overthrown cities persistently committed grave sins. 9 They did not follow the Messenger of their Lord, and so He seized them with a severe grip. 10 Verily! When the water rose beyond its limits [Nuh's (Noah) Flood], We carried you (mankind) in the floating [ship that was constructed by Nuh (Noah)]. 11 That We might make it for you a reminder and [that] a conscious ear would be conscious of it. 12 So when the Trumpet is blown with a single blast 13 And the earth and the mountains are lifted and leveled with one blow - 14 On that day, the inevitable event will take place 15 And the sky will be rent asunder, for on that Day it will be so frail. 16 The angels will stand on all its sides. And on that Day, eight (of them) will carry the Throne of your Lord above them. 17 On that Day you will be brought to judgement and none of your secrets will remain hidden. 18 Then as for him who is given his book in his right hand, he shall say, 'Here, take and read my book! 19 Verily I was sure that I would be handed over my account.” 20 So he shall be in a life of pleasure, 21 In a lofty Paradise, 22 With fruits hanging low within reach, 23 (It will be said): 'Eat and drink with a good appetite because of what you did in days long passed' 24 As for him whose Record will be given to him in his left hand, he will exclaim: “Would that I had never been given my Record, 25 Nor that I knew my reckoning! 26 Would that it (my death) had ended it all! 27 My riches have not availed me, 28 my authority is gone from me.' 29 [Allah will say], "Seize him and shackle him. 30 Then in the Scorch roast him 31 And then insert him in a chain whereof the length is seventy cubits. 32 Indeed, he did not use to believe in Allah, the Most Great, 33 “And did not urge to feed the needy.” 34 so today he has no friend here, 35 and has no food except the filth from the washing of wounds, 36 None shall eat it but the sinners. 37
